Transaction 80deefea71efa709382306671afbefcc40e76d37fcb558a2e29e69fd0f55facf

2 Input
2 Outputs
  • 80deefea71efa709382306671afbefcc40e76d37fcb558a2e29e69fd0f55facf:0
  • value  1522467
    address  3Lr7T5hLHjcaEjn46g86wzyBBfoNnf8Eze
  • 80deefea71efa709382306671afbefcc40e76d37fcb558a2e29e69fd0f55facf:1
  • value  263981
    address  1HZnj4eaqNEy64Yn2MNcXYu5Mebt7b2qqc